#ifndef _AHT20_H
#define _AHT20_H
#include "user.h"
#define MYI2C_Tick 10//定时调用时间,单位:毫秒请根据定时调用时间设置定时调用时间设置范围1-100ms
#define MYI2C_Buffer_Size 20
#define Wait_Ack_time 199//等待ACK应答时间单位:微秒
#define MinReadTim 500//读取传感器最小间隔时间,单位:毫秒
#define PowerOnTim 10//上电延迟10毫秒
#define MeasureTim 150//等待测量结果延迟150毫秒
#define SENSOR_IDLE 0 //
#define SENSOR_MEASURE 1 //
#define SENSOR_COMPLETE 2 //
typedef struct
{
uint8_t Adrr;
uint16_t timcnt;
uint8_t ErrFlag;
uint8_t Step;
uint16_t SetRTim;
uint8_t SendByte[MYI2C_Buffer_Size];
uint8_t ReadByte[MYI2C_Buffer_Size];
float RH;//湿度
float T;//温度
}MYI2C_Struct;
extern MYI2C_Struct SENx;
uint8_t AHT20_READ_FUNC(MYI2C_Struct *pst,uint8_t device_addr,uint8_t register_addr,uint8_t *pDat,uint8_t len);
uint8_t AHT20_WRITE_FUNC(MYI2C_Struct *pst,uint8_t device_addr,uint8_t register_addr,uint8_t *pDat,uint8_t len);
uint8_t CheckCrc8(uint8_t *pDat,uint8_t Lenth);
/* Exported functions ------------------------------------------------------- */
void AHT20_Init(MYI2C_Struct *pst,uint16_t ReadTimMS,uint16_t xAddr);
void AHT20_Handle(MYI2C_Struct *pst);
#endif
